    Union Minister for Ports, Shipping and Waterways Sarbananda Sonowal will flag off the Very Large Gas Carrier (VLGC) vessel Shivalik during its maiden call to India at Visakhapatnam Port today.

    The Shivalik, recently acquired and inducted under the Indian flag by the Shipping Corporation of India (SCI) on September 10, marks an important milestone in India’s maritime growth story. The vessel, operating under Indian ownership and flag, is scheduled to call at Visakhapatnam Port to discharge its maiden LPG cargo.

    This will be Shivalik’s first arrival in India under the Indian flag. The event highlights the country’s expanding capabilities in energy transportation, maritime safety, and global competitiveness, further strengthening its standing in the international maritime sector, according to a release from the Visakhapatnam Port Authority.

    The Union Minister will also attend a public meeting at Sagarmala Conventions, Saligrampuram, where he will inaugurate a range of developmental projects undertaken by the Visakhapatnam Port Authority aligned with the Maritime India Vision 2030.
